Bu işlemi "scp" ile elle taşıma yaptım. Sırasıyla anlatmak istiyorum.

scp yönetmini kullanmak çok kolaymış, ilk önce yeni server'a ssh ile bağlanıyoruz. bağlanır bağlanmaz aşağıdaki kodu kendimize uyarlayıp yazıyoruz;

scp -r eskiFtpKulAdı@eskiServerIP:KaynakKlasör HedefKlasör
Örn:
scp -r zayiflamax@5.5.5.5:/home/zayiflamax/public_html /home/zayiflam
bu şekilde "public_html" içindeki tüm klasörleri "public_html" klasörüne atıyor. Yol oalrak yukarıda yazdığımı referans alın. Çünkü hedef klasör olarak "/home/zayiflam/public_html" yazarsanız, aynı klasör içinde "public_html" klasörünü tekrar açıyor. Dikkat etmekte fayda var.

Kopyalama tamamlandıktan sonra CHOWN ile dosya yetkisi vermeniz gerekiyor, bunun için "cd" komutlarıyla ilgili sitenin (bendeki "zayiflam") public_html içine girin ve şunu yazın;

chown -R FtpKullanıcıAdı:FtpKullanıcıAdı *
Örn:

chown -R zayiflam:zayiflam *
Sonra CHMOD ile 755 vermemiz gerekiyor:

chmod -R 755 *
Dosya taşıması bu kadar. Bundan sonraki SQL dump olayı ama onu ssh yerine elle yaparsanız çok iyi olur.

Yaklaşık 10 siteden 100.000 den fazla dosya 1 saat içinde bitti. Sadece sql kaldı, onunla uğraşıyorum şimdi.

Kolay gelsin.